Yantra Tantra constitutes an ancient Indian spiritual science based on the inseparable triad of Mantra (sound), Tantra (technique), and Yantra (geometric form) to channel spiritual energy. It functions as a "machine" to facilitate concentration and manifest spiritual states through rituals, mudras, and the meditation on geometric diagrams like the Shri Yantra.
